This episode reflects on the intersection of art, community, and resilience during the WAW Pass the Hat Tour 2025. Together with AI co-host Sophia, we explore how live music builds temporary communities of belonging, how pub politics can paradoxically highlight the need for solidarity, and how art functions as ritual and survival in contemporary society.
The episode culminates in the premiere of Three Hats, One Road by Los Inorgánicos, a song inspired directly by the tour itself.
In addition, we announce WAW’s forthcoming album The Stories of Nil Young — with its debut single The Nile’s Bittersweet Song arriving soon.

Lyrics – Three Hats, One Road (Los Inorgánicos)
Verse 1
We carried our songs through the rain and the stone,
Three hats in the circle, three chords of our own.
From Ardgole rocks to Kilcrohane nights,
The fire kept burning, the music took flight.
Chorus
Three hats, one road,
Pass it around, let the love overflow.
From the cliffs to the crowd, from the pub to the shore,
We sang what was ours till it wasn’t anymore.
Verse 2
Whiskey was flowing, the candles burned low,
Hannah at the doorway let the whole village know.
Voices joined voices, the night broke apart,
Strangers turned family with songs from the heart.
Chorus
Three hats, one road,
Pass it around, let the love overflow.
From the cliffs to the crowd, from the pub to the shore,
We sang what was ours till it wasn’t anymore.
Bridge
Cows for companions, a floor made of stone,
But the silence at sunrise was music alone.
Prawns on the beach, with the tide rolling in,
A hymn to the journey, where love will begin.
Final Chorus
Three hats, one road,
Pass it along, let the stories be told.
From the cliffs to the crowd, from the pub to the shore,
We sang what was ours till it’s everyone’s lore.

Detlef Schlich is a rock musician, podcaster, visual artist, filmmaker, ritual designer, and media archaeologist based in West Cork. He is recognised for his seminal work, including a scholarly examination of the intersections between shamanism, art, and digital culture, and his acclaimed video installation, Transodin's Tragedy. He primarily works in performance, photography, painting, sound, installations, and film. In his work, he reflects on the human condition and uses the digital shaman's methodology as an alter ego to create artwork. His media archaeology is a conceptual and practical exercise in uncovering the unique aesthetic, cultural, and political aspects of media in culture.Detlef Schlich
